New research reveals that while the same yeast dominates sourdough starters, the type of flour used can significantly alter bacterial composition. The findings highlight how subtle ingredient choices can influence fermentation behavior and bread characteristics.

ICL has signed a definitive agreement to acquire Bartek Ingredients, a global supplier of food-grade malic and fumaric acid used across food, beverage and personal care applications. The phased transaction positions ICL to expand capacity and capitalize on a functional ingredients market projected to top $45 billion by 2030.
Administration orders accelerated rescheduling to Schedule III while signaling tighter oversight and clearer standards for hemp-derived cannabinoids used in foods and beverages
The federal government is moving to formally recognize marijuana’s accepted medical use and accelerate its rescheduling from Schedule I to Schedule III under the Controlled Substances Act. This shift is based on FDA, HHS and NIH findings showing credible scientific support for marijuana’s use in treating pain, nausea, vomiting and anorexia related to medical conditions.

According to the report, dark sweet cherry will be a standout flavor in 2026 due to its striking deep red color, intense sweetness and impressive versatility. With a complex flavor profile described as “juicy, rich and tart,” dark sweet cherry is a nostalgic favorite for many North American consumers familiar with varieties such as Chelan, Sweetheart, Lapin, Stella, Bing and more.
